> When bridging to an undefined clojure method, the `Var` lookup will return 
> `null`. When this `null` is injected into the `PlasticField`, either an 
> `AssertionError` will be thrown, or, if assertions are disabled, a 
> `NullPointerException` will eventually be thrown from somewhere deep in the 
> generated bytecode. A meaningful exception would be better in that case.
